WebMar 27, 2024 · Emilio Aguinaldo was a military, political, and revolutionary leader who served as the inaugural President of Philippines. Aguinaldo served from January 23, 1899 until March 23, 1901. Before becoming the President, he led the country against Spain in the Philippine Revolution between 1896 and 1898. Emilio Aguinaldo was born on March 22, 1869 in Kawit, Cavite. His father was appointed by the Spanish colonial government as gobernadorcillo of Kawit. In 1895, Aguinaldo’s personal penchant for politics was evident when he became a cabeza de barangay in 1895.
